Abstract

Summary Because access to transplantation with HLA-desensitization protocols and ABO incompatible transplantation is very limited due to high costs and increased risk of infections from more intense immunosuppression, kidney paired donation (KPD) promises hope to a growing number of end-stage renal disease (ESRD) patient in India. We present a government and institutional ethical review board approved study of 56 ESRD patients [25 two-way and 2 three-way pairs] who consented to participate in KPD transplantation at our center in 2013, performed to avoid blood group incompatibility (n = 52) or positive cross-match (n = 4). All patients had anatomic, functional, and immunologically comparable donors. The waiting time in KPD was short as compared to deceased donor transplantation. Laparoscopic donor nephrectomy was performed in 54 donors. Donor relationships were spousal (n = 40), parental (n = 13), others (n = 3), with median HLA match of 1. Graft survival was 97.5%. Three patients died with functioning graft. 16% had biopsy-proven acute rejection. Mean serum creatinine was 1.2 mg/dl at 0.73 ± 0.32 months follow-up. KPD is a viable, legal, and rapidly growing modality for facilitating LDRT for patients who are incompatible with their healthy, willing living donor. To our knowledge, this is the largest single-center report from India.
